11 qualities in men that women find attractive
Business Insider ^ | Rebecca Harrington, Tech Insider

Posted on 02/21/2019 2:27:34 PM PST by SeekAndFind

Be honest, straight men: You all want to know what women want. Luckily, a bunch of scientists have wondered the same thing.

These types of studies are often small, and frequently rely on self-reported feelings in a lab, which may be different from how women truly react in real life. And the participants are often Western college students, who are not an especially a diverse group. So take the results with a grain of salt.

But hey, whatever helps, right?

Here are 11 science-supported traits that women find irresistible.

1. Good looks can be a factor, but they're not as important as you may think. In studies, women typically choose better-looking guys for flings, not long-term relationships.

2. A sense of humor is important to women. Scientists have found it makes men seem more intelligent.

3. For long relationships, women tend to prefer altruistic men who are kind and do good deeds.

4. In studies, women choose men posing in front of expensive cars or apartments, versus ordinary ones, possibly because they make the men appear rich.

5. Women may like older men because they've had time to accumulate more resources.

6. Facial hair has been an attraction and a repellent in studies, so that feature is likely based on preference. Do what you want with your face; you'll attract the right mate.

7. Older research concluded that people liked when other people liked them, but recent studies have found that "playing hard to get" could be an effective tactic. When men are unavailable, that might make women want them more.

8. Small studies have indicated that men with dogs do better with the ladies.

9. In one speed-dating experiment, women were more attracted to men who were mindful — present, attentive, and nonjudgmental.
